Mom found dead with ‘brain matter visible’ after being beaten with rock by daughter: cops

MILWAUKEE (CBS Newspath//WDJT/WKRC) – A woman was found dead with “brain matter visible” after her daughter allegedly beat her with a rock.

Carrie Zettel called 911 at 2:06 p.m. on Sunday, Oct. 12, reporting that her daughter, Lauren Spors, 29, was “being violent.” When police arrived 14 minutes later, they discovered Zettel with “severe trauma to her head with brain matter visible,” covered in blood near her home. A blood-stained rock was found in the grass near her body, and she was pronounced dead shortly after, per WTMJ.

Officers arrested Spors, who was covered in what was believed to be her mother’s blood. Neighbors speaking to WTMJ said they had seen Spors asleep in Zettel’s front lawn the morning prior to the attack, and was later seen pacing back and forth in front of the house around an hour before the incident, per the station’s report.

A 2018 petition for a temporary restraining order revealed Zettel had previously reported that her daughter “threatened life with a knife in hand after she struck her father repeatedly on [his] head with heavy decorative bottles.” Zettel also stated that her daughter had thrown heavy items at them and resisted staying at a halfway house. Zettel claimed her daughter had even put her father’s head through drywall. A neighbor reported that the father died a few days later, per WDJT-TV.

WTMJ reported that Spors violated a no contact order several times, but each time doctors determined she was not competent to move forward with court proceedings.

In a letter written shortly after her father’s death, Spors said, “I haven’t accepted my dad’s death. My mom says I killed him, but I don’t remember doing it.” She acknowledged acting out due to her mental illness.

When speaking to WITI, CEO of Sojourner Family Peace Center said, “the system has failed,” adding, “It does sound like she did everything we would suggest she do, and that’s what makes it even more painful.”

A complaint obtained by WITI states that friends said Zettel had told others that her daughter suffered from schizophrenia.

Criminal complaints indicate that Spors violated a domestic abuse injunction in March and April 2018. In December 2021, documents show she threw rocks through windows at 2 a.m. to enter Zettel’s home, leading to her arrest and charges of misdemeanor battery and theft.

According to WTMJ, Spors made a court appearance on Tuesday and faces life in prison if convicted.
